Twice a year, in Central Park, I invite engaged couples to join in our Free Engagement Photo Day. The engagement is a very sweet time in your relationship, so different than being married and certainly different than dating. It’s a perfect time to mark together with pictures.

An engagement shoot is a super fun, totally relaxed time to be together and make pictures. And it’s the perfect opportunity to get in front of the camera and be with your photographer creating that comfort zone and familiarity. When your wedding day arrives, you’ve already had an experience together and you know what to expect. That way you can be comfortable, enjoy your own wedding, relax and look your natural best.

As you know, I'm the Festival Photographer at the Jacob's Pillow Dance Festival in Becket, MA. There a get to photograph artists and dancers from around the world. This summer the Trey McIntyre Project had their debut as a full time company. In addition to being a great choreographer, Trey McIntyre is a super nice person. The whole company was a joy to be around and a great company to end the Pillow summer with.
